Abstract :
The work presents the results of investigations of electrical properties of the LiNi1−yCoyO2 system (y=0, 0.25, 0.5, 0.85) in a wide temperature range (300–1073 K) and oxygen pressures ranging from 10−4 to 1 atm. It was found that the replacement of nickel by cobalt in LiNi1−yCoyO2 eliminates the presence of a disadvantageous phase transition observed in LiNiO2 and reduces “cations mixing” phenomenon. However, for cobalt content y≫0.25 there is a significant deterioration of transport properties related to a drop in the effective carriers concentration.
